Output 38add896da689a28fccae10524c55a5fe063a50f66329d9a2782adb07efc85d2:0

value
12602865698
script pubkey
OP_0 OP_PUSHBYTES_20 67527921156a7345d0b4affb2891ed0d2871ce31
address
ltc1qvaf8jgg4dfe5t5954laj3y0dp558rn33m2mqgt
transaction
38add896da689a28fccae10524c55a5fe063a50f66329d9a2782adb07efc85d2
spent
true